BS43-91 Marine Recoatable Polyurethane Finish
Product Description
BS43-91 Marine Recoatable Polyurethane Finish
Product Introduction:
BS43-91 BS43-91 Recoatable Polyurethane Finish is a two-component aliphatic polyurethane finish, designed as a high-performance decorative topcoat for marine applications. It delivers excellent durability, outstanding gloss retention, and long-term recoatability, making it an ideal choice for newbuilding, maintenance, repair, and onboard maintenance projects.
Key Features:
1.Long-Term Recoatability: The coating can be directly overcoated onto aged 725-BS43-91 surfaces after proper cleaning, provided the old film remains intact and firmly adhered.
2.High Solids Content: With a volume solids of 60% ± 2%, it ensures high film build and efficient coverage.
3.Low VOC: VOC content is less than 390 g/L, meeting modern environmental requirements.
4.Versatile Application: Suitable for airless spray (tip size 0.38–0.53 mm), conventional spray (tip size 2.0–3.0 mm), and brush/roller application for small areas.
5.Fast Drying: Dries quickly across a wide temperature range (from -5°C to 35°C), with pot life varying from 8 hours (at -5°C) to 4 hours (at 35°C).
Film Thickness & Theoretical Coverage:
| Parameter | Minimum | Standard | Maximum |
| Dry Film Thickness (DFT) | 30 μm | 40 μm | 80 μm |
| Wet Film Thickness (WFT) | 50 μm | 67 μm | 133 μm |
| Theoretical Coverage | 20 m²/L | 15 m²/L | 7.5 m²/L |
Recommended Use:
This finish is specifically formulated for above-water areas on vessels. It performs exceptionally well as a cosmetic and protective layer over recommended primer systems. For repair work, damaged areas should be prepared to St3 standard and spot-primed before full coating application.
Surface Preparation & Application:
*Surfaces must be clean, dry, and free from oil, grease, and soluble contaminants (per SSPC-SP1).
*High-pressure fresh water washing is recommended before overcoating.
*Apply when surface temperature is at least 3°C above dew point and relative humidity is below 85%.
Limitations:
*Not recommended for immersed/underwater service.
*Brush/roller application may require two coats for uniform coverage, especially over dark primers.
*Drying and overcoating intervals may vary with on-site environmental conditions.
